安装和配置 Reactjs:接下来,我们将设置 Reactjs,作为我们的前端框架。Reactjs 是一个用于构建用户界面的 JavaScript 库。我们将使用 Create React App 来快速创建 React 项目。 API 交互:最后,我们将通过 API 将 Django 和 Reactjs 集成在一起。前端将通过 API 获取数据,并将数据呈现给用户。后端将处理用户的请...
我们将学习使用 Django REST Framework 在 Django 后端和 React js 前端之间进行通信的过程。为了更好地理解这个概念,我们将构建一个简单的任务管理器,并介绍 React js 和 Django 之间这种类型的集成的主要概念。 对于这个项目,React 将作为前端,通过对 Django 后端的请求处理用户界面(UI)。 项目概况: 让我们首先看...
2. 安装 React 开发相关的依赖 $ npm install --save-dev babel-cli babel-loader babel-preset-env babel-preset-react babel-preset-stage-0 react react-dom react-hot-loader webpack webpack-cli webpack-bundle-tracker webpack-dev-server 其中,--save-dev会把依赖写入package.json。这些第三方库位于当...
第二步,生成一个django工程文件处理数据 1、在views.py文件下,创建函数,在获取浏览器GET请求的时候,返回给浏览器index.html(就是刚才react中生成的工程文件index.html) defAjaxLoad2(request):ifrequest.method=="GET":returnrender(request,"index.html") 2、在views.py文件下,创建函数,在获得浏览器POST请求时,...
React.js是一个由Facebook开发的用于构建用户界面的JavaScript库。它采用了组件化的开发方式,将用户界面拆分为独立可复用的组件,使得开发者能够更高效地构建复杂的UI。 生产环境中,Django和React.js常常被同时使用,它们的结合可以发挥各自的优势,提供一种完整且高效的Web开发解决方案。 在使用Django和React.js的生产环境...
// 使用JS变量 const element = Hello, {name}; 组件:可以简单理解为,React认为UI应该是组件化的,就像搭积木一样,由一个一个组件搭起来,这样将一个大页面的工作拆分为很多个小组件,便于复用,也方便多人协作开发。之前看到的<App />就是一个组件。 生命周期函数:...
React和Django是两个独立的技术栈,React是一个用于构建用户界面的JavaScript库,而Django是一个用于构建Web应用程序的Python框架。要将React与Django连接起来,可以通过以下步骤: 创建Django项目:首先,使用Django命令行工具创建一个新的Django项目。 设置Django后端API:在Django项目中,你可以创建一个或多个API视图,用于处理前...
By clicking “Post Your Answer”, you agree to ourterms of serviceand acknowledge you have read ourprivacy policy. Not the answer you're looking for? Browse other questions tagged reactjs django-rest-framework orask your own question.
I got django runing on apache on address localhost:8001 and react app running on nginx on localhost:8005. Also I use ngingx to route proxy. My biggest problem is when I try to call DRF API by React (calling http://127.0.0.1:8001/api-token-auth/ so I got / at the end of the ...
此教程共8小时,中英双语字幕,画质清晰无水印,源码附件齐全!课程英文名:React, Next.js and Django A Rapid Guide - Advanced React with Typescript, Next.js, Redux, DRF 3.1, Docker, Redis, Stripe, Front…